chinaproductcenter logo

F004308, At199702, 5007523, 0056127 Johndeere U-Joints

F004308, At199702, 5007523, 0056127 Johndeere U-Joints
Our company supply the John Deree universal joints and drive shafts and other driveline components.  Komatsu U-Joints...

[ , ]